In 1709, Daniel Fitch entered the world in Montville, New London, Connecticut, USA, born to Daniel Fitch And Mary Bradford. Daniel Fitch married Sarah Sherwood. Daniel Fitch passed away in 1755 in Oakdale, New London County, Connecticut, United States of America.
